Home
last modified time | relevance | path

Searched refs:wowlan_config (Results 1 – 12 of 12) sorted by relevance

/linux/net/wireless/
H A Dcore.h135 if (!rdev->wiphy.wowlan_config) in cfg80211_rdev_free_wowlan()
137 for (i = 0; i < rdev->wiphy.wowlan_config->n_patterns; i++) in cfg80211_rdev_free_wowlan()
138 kfree(rdev->wiphy.wowlan_config->patterns[i].mask); in cfg80211_rdev_free_wowlan()
139 kfree(rdev->wiphy.wowlan_config->patterns); in cfg80211_rdev_free_wowlan()
140 if (rdev->wiphy.wowlan_config->tcp && in cfg80211_rdev_free_wowlan()
141 rdev->wiphy.wowlan_config->tcp->sock) in cfg80211_rdev_free_wowlan()
142 sock_release(rdev->wiphy.wowlan_config->tcp->sock); in cfg80211_rdev_free_wowlan()
143 kfree(rdev->wiphy.wowlan_config->tcp); in cfg80211_rdev_free_wowlan()
144 kfree(rdev->wiphy.wowlan_config->nd_config); in cfg80211_rdev_free_wowlan()
145 kfree(rdev->wiphy.wowlan_config); in cfg80211_rdev_free_wowlan()
H A Dsysfs.c104 if (!rdev->wiphy.wowlan_config) { in wiphy_suspend()
110 ret = rdev_suspend(rdev, rdev->wiphy.wowlan_config); in wiphy_suspend()
H A Dnl80211.c13362 struct cfg80211_wowlan *wowlan = rdev->wiphy.wowlan_config; in nl80211_send_wowlan_patterns()
13536 if (rdev->wiphy.wowlan_config && rdev->wiphy.wowlan_config->tcp) { in nl80211_get_wowlan()
13538 size += rdev->wiphy.wowlan_config->tcp->tokens_size + in nl80211_get_wowlan()
13539 rdev->wiphy.wowlan_config->tcp->payload_len + in nl80211_get_wowlan()
13540 rdev->wiphy.wowlan_config->tcp->wake_len + in nl80211_get_wowlan()
13541 rdev->wiphy.wowlan_config->tcp->wake_len / 8; in nl80211_get_wowlan()
13553 if (rdev->wiphy.wowlan_config) { in nl80211_get_wowlan()
13561 if ((rdev->wiphy.wowlan_config->any && in nl80211_get_wowlan()
13563 (rdev->wiphy.wowlan_config->disconnect && in nl80211_get_wowlan()
13565 (rdev->wiphy.wowlan_config->magic_pkt && in nl80211_get_wowlan()
[all …]
H A Dcore.c1169 if (rdev->wiphy.wowlan_config && rdev->ops->set_wakeup) in wiphy_unregister()
/linux/drivers/net/wireless/marvell/mwifiex/
H A Dsta_ioctl.c512 if (priv->wdev.wiphy->wowlan_config && in mwifiex_enable_hs()
513 !priv->wdev.wiphy->wowlan_config->nd_config) { in mwifiex_enable_hs()
H A Dcfg80211.c3587 if (!wiphy->wowlan_config) in mwifiex_cfg80211_resume()
3609 if (wiphy->wowlan_config->disconnect) in mwifiex_cfg80211_resume()
3611 if (wiphy->wowlan_config->nd_config) in mwifiex_cfg80211_resume()
3617 if (wiphy->wowlan_config->magic_pkt) in mwifiex_cfg80211_resume()
3619 if (wiphy->wowlan_config->n_patterns) in mwifiex_cfg80211_resume()
3623 if (wiphy->wowlan_config->gtk_rekey_failure) in mwifiex_cfg80211_resume()
H A Dscan.c2171 if (priv->wdev.wiphy->wowlan_config) in mwifiex_ret_802_11_scan()
2172 nd_config = priv->wdev.wiphy->wowlan_config->nd_config; in mwifiex_ret_802_11_scan()
/linux/drivers/net/wireless/rsi/
H A Drsi_91x_sdio.c1455 if (hw && hw->wiphy && hw->wiphy->wowlan_config) { in rsi_shutdown()
1456 if (rsi_config_wowlan(adapter, hw->wiphy->wowlan_config)) in rsi_shutdown()
/linux/drivers/net/wireless/mediatek/mt76/
H A Dmt76_connac_mcu.c2572 struct cfg80211_wowlan *wowlan = hw->wiphy->wowlan_config; in mt76_connac_mcu_set_suspend_iter()
/linux/drivers/net/wireless/intel/iwlwifi/mvm/
H A Dd3.c3754 err = __iwl_mvm_suspend(mvm->hw, mvm->hw->wiphy->wowlan_config, true); in iwl_mvm_d3_test_open()
/linux/include/net/
H A Dcfg80211.h5736 struct cfg80211_wowlan *wowlan_config; member
/linux/drivers/net/wireless/mediatek/mt76/mt7925/
H A Dmcu.c260 struct cfg80211_wowlan *wowlan = hw->wiphy->wowlan_config; in mt7925_mcu_set_suspend_iter()